]> git.karo-electronics.de Git - karo-tx-linux.git/commit
drivers/video: add Hyper-V Synthetic Video Frame Buffer Driver
authorHaiyang Zhang <haiyangz@microsoft.com>
Wed, 20 Mar 2013 04:06:53 +0000 (15:06 +1100)
committerStephen Rothwell <sfr@canb.auug.org.au>
Thu, 21 Mar 2013 05:27:14 +0000 (16:27 +1100)
commit232f5538bbf78c785b692adf0ee007eb763aa4b6
treeeb48cb368f33e1456a00e9399c05489dad74bd80
parentd9564008ca0c570e281eb0c01b1f950cc9c45dc1
drivers/video: add Hyper-V Synthetic Video Frame Buffer Driver

This is the driver for the Hyper-V Synthetic Video, which supports screen
resolution up to Full HD 1920x1080 on Windows Server 2012 host, and
1600x1200 on Windows Server 2008 R2 or earlier.  It also solves the double
mouse cursor issue of the emulated video mode.

Signed-off-by: Haiyang Zhang <haiyangz@microsoft.com>
Reviewed-by: K. Y. Srinivasan <kys@microsoft.com>
Cc: Greg Kroah-Hartman <gregkh@linuxfoundation.org>,
Cc: Olaf Hering <olaf@aepfle.de>
Cc: Geert Uytterhoeven <geert@linux-m68k.org>
Cc: Florian Tobias Schandinat <FlorianSchandinat@gmx.de>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
drivers/video/Kconfig
drivers/video/Makefile
drivers/video/hyperv_fb.c [new file with mode: 0644]
include/linux/hyperv.h